Bayshore Gifts & Gallery is a sunny corner of the Coos Bay boardwalk packed with artisan gifts, local art, coastal apparel, jewelry, toys, and souvenirs. Most of it is sustainably sourced from small businesses and Oregon makers.

A shop wrapped in a mural, and giving back to more

The artist series socks are part of an Art Giveback program, so a piece of every pair supports working artists and community mural projects. You will find them with the apparel, in a shop wrapped in a hand painted mural.
